Installation
Install a new lip seal in the brake caliper. Place a new protective cap on the brake cylinder piston as shown in the figure.

Tighten the clamping nut to size "a" 15 mm.

Install the protective cap into the groove on the brake caliper. Use wedge "3409" for this. Carefully push the brake cylinder piston into the brake caliper.

At the same time, move the brake cylinder piston. The brake cylinder piston must be mounted on the clamping nut, this is only possible in 4 positions. Press the brake cylinder piston after it is positioned on the clamping nut until it stops in the brake caliper.

Be careful not to damage the clamping nut. Turn the clamping nut clockwise until it stops.
